Sabina : Off White and Black Handwoven Gadwal Silk Saree with Gold Zari

Make a sophisticated statement with Sabina, a striking Handwoven Gadwal Silk Saree that effortlessly pairs pristine off-white with rich black. Featuring delicate golden buttis scattered across the pristine off-white body, this saree is dramatically framed by a broad black border woven with classic temple (kumbh) patterns and gold zari work.

The rich black pallu is richly embellished with intricate gold zari brocade and traditional paisley (kalka) motifs, offering an opulent contrast. Handwoven by master artisans, this saree comes with a Silk Mark Certification, guaranteeing 100% authentic, pure silk quality.

Care Instructions

  • Cleaning: Dry Clean Only.

  • Storage: Store wrapped in a soft cotton or muslin cloth in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.

  • Disclaimer & Handloom Authenticity Note

  • Handloom Characteristics: Due to the authentic handweaving process on traditional looms, small pin holes near the motifs and borders are a natural part of the weaving technique and are not considered defects.Subtle variations in texture, weaving lines, or light finish variations are natural hallmarks of authentic silk craftsmanship, adding individual character to every saree.
